DeepSeek R1 (the full 680B model) runs nicely in higher quality 4-bit on 3 M2 Ultras with MLX. Asked it a coding question and it thought for ~2k tokens and generated 3500 tokens overall:

Prompt (h/t @ivanfioravanti): "write a python script for a bouncing yellow ball within a square, make sure to handle collision detection properly. make the square slowly rotate. implement it in python. make sure ball stays within the square" Code ran no edits and the result is actually pretty decent:
